EXTL2 (Exostosin-Like Glycosyltransferase 2) is a gene that encodes an enzyme involved in the production of heparan sulfate, a key component of the extracellular matrix. Heparan sulfate interacts with various growth factors and signaling molecules, playing important roles in cell proliferation, adhesion, and differentiation. EXTL2’s function in heparan sulfate synthesis underscores its importance in development and maintaining tissue health.
